How Detoxification Works in Middlebury, Vermont

For many clients in a drug and alcohol addiction rehab center, the first stages of detox can be severe. As a direct result, the program might have mental health and medical staff members standing by to offer you the effective assistance, management, and oversight you require as your body gets rid of the drugs you used to take.

For example, several hours after you take your last heroin dose, you might experience withdrawal, which may be expressed as:

  • Anxiety
  • Excessive yawning
  • Agitation
  • Difficulty sleeping
  • Sweating
  • Runny nose
  • Muscle aches
  • Increasing tearing of the eyes

Even though you may think that these symptoms aren't life threatening, you can still be sure that they may be so uncomfortable that you would be inclined to begin abusing heroin again. This is why you should have access to medical and mental health care while enduring detoxification.

Additionally, you can experience other issues when you enroll in a detox center - especially in the first couple of hours following your last dose of the drugs your body is dependent on.

While this is occurring, the detox facility in Middlebury will address the most urgent of these issues initially before achieving total stability. Specific issues you may experience include but are not always limited to:

  • Threat to self
  • Medical illness
  • Injury
  • Violence
  • Symptoms of psychosis

You may also feel intense cravings for your drug of choice. To make sure you do not relapse, the detoxification may prescribe specific replacement medications or slowly wean you off from these substances.
